Your "MSG command" ladder logic is not quite functional within a Logix system.
Delete all the "Rung-Conditions-In" instructions and replace them with the ExpconWrMSG.EN XIO (normally closed); you could add your Test_MSG XIC(normally open) instruction in a Logical AND (Series)within the MSG control rung for user On/Off switching purposes, however, as a rule of thumb, within a Logix system, a MSG instruction will be serviced at all times when it is not enabled.
